HeadFirst Group, market leader in professionally organizing external hiring, has appointed Han Kolff - also chairman of the board - as CEO. He takes over this role from Gert-Jan Schellingerhout.

The organization's growth strategy, both nationally and internationally, will continue under the leadership of Han Kolff. The focus here is on perpetuating and expanding its role as a full service HR service provider, innovating with smart online solutions and adding value with rich data. Han Kolff: "We believe that scale, strengthened by our online platform, and combined with a personal approach is the key to success. I look forward to realizing our ambitions together."

About Han Kolff
Kolff has a long track record at major international organizations, including ten years in HR services. He held executive positions at Randstad, Danone and Heineken, among others. He has also been involved in digital business transformations, HR tech startups and scale-ups. Since March of this year, Kolff has already held the position of chairman of the board at HeadFirst Group.

About HeadFirst Group
HeadFirst Group is the market leader in the Benelux in the professional organization of external hiring. The organization offers a diversity of flex solutions, including contracting, matchmaking, msp services and business consultancy. Every day more than 10,000 professionals work for over 350 clients in Europe, with which HeadFirst Group realizes an annual turnover of over 1 billion euros. The main brands of HeadFirst Group are intermediaries HeadFirst and Myler and msp service provider Staffing Management Services.

HeadFirst Group and ONL voor Ondernemers are joining forces as of March 1. Last week Gert-Jan Schellingerhout, CEO HeadFirst Group, and Mike Korenvaar, CFO HeadFirst Group, signed the cooperation agreement together with ONL chairman Hans Biesheuvel. Both parties will act together for a fair flexible labor market in which hirers and providers of knowledge - and organizations that connect them - have room to do business. Monitoring and positively influencing labor market legislation, with the replacement of the Wet DBA in the lead, is a spearhead.

About ONL for Entrepreneurs

ONL voor Ondernemers aims to make the Netherlands more entrepreneurial together. The entrepreneurs' organization makes the voice of the entrepreneur heard by lobbying, raising problems and proposing solutions for issues that affect entrepreneurs. ONL takes a critical stance against ramshackle legislation, such as the DBA Act and the Employment and Security Act, but not without presenting a well thought-out alternative that will benefit entrepreneurs.
